#4cb0e1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4cb0e1 is composed of 29.8% red, 69%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 21.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 199.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 59%. #4cb0e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#0061c3.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#4cb0e1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010406 is the darkest color, while #f4f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4cb0e1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949799 is the less saturated color, while #34b8f9 is the most saturated one.
